Output d727bfa37eaf3fbd33ffff9c46a237d0cf516c8501dbebe71977857edfe07d02:4

value
964914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c4de32e08bc2658c521d3c65611a632f147fe7 OP_EQUAL
address
3MTBic3epcXG34QrYDZXzmejph42wkV3St
transaction
d727bfa37eaf3fbd33ffff9c46a237d0cf516c8501dbebe71977857edfe07d02
confirmations
293909
spent
true